Key Roles in Property Management

Effective property management relies on a diverse team of professionals, each bringing their unique skills and expertise. Here are some of the key roles that are essential to the success of a property management team:

1. Property Manager

The property manager is the backbone of the property management team. They are responsible for overseeing the property’s day-to-day operations, ensuring that everything runs smoothly. Their duties include managing budgets, handling tenant relations, coordinating maintenance, and ensuring compliance with local laws and regulations. A skilled property manager is crucial for maintaining high occupancy rates and tenant satisfaction.

2. Leasing Agent

Leasing agents are the face of the property for prospective tenants. They handle property showings, lease negotiations, and tenant screenings. Their ability to effectively market the property and close deals directly impacts its rates and revenue. Leasing agents need excellent communication and sales skills to attract and retain tenants.

3. Maintenance Technician

Maintenance technicians ensure that the property remains in good condition. They handle repairs, perform routine maintenance, and address any urgent issues. A reliable maintenance team can significantly reduce tenant turnover by resolving problems quickly and efficiently. Their work helps maintain the property’s property attractiveness.

4. Administrative Assistant

Administrative assistants provide essential support to the property management team. They handle tasks such as managing paperwork, answering phones, scheduling appointments, and assisting with tenant communications. Their organizational skills keep the office running smoothly and help ensure nothing falls through the cracks.

5. Accountant/Bookkeeper

Accurate financial management is critical in property management. Accountants and bookkeepers manage the properties, including rent collection, expense tracking, and financial reporting. Their expertise ensures that the property remains financially healthy and that all financial obligations are met.

6. Security Personnel

For properties that require additional security, security personnel play a vital role in ensuring the safety of tenants and the property. They monitor the premises, handle security breaches, and provide peace of mind to both tenants and property managers. The Impact of Effective Staffing on Property Performance

Effective staffing in property management goes beyond simply filling positions. It involves selecting the right individuals, providing them with the necessary training, and fostering a positive work environment. Here’s how Here’sive staffing impacts property performance:

1. Enhanced Tenant Satisfaction

Tenants are more likely to stay in a property where they feel valued, and their needs are promptly addressed. Professional and courteous staff, including property managers, leasing agents, and maintenance technicians, contribute to a positive tenant experience. Happy tenants are more likely to renew their leases, reducing turnover and vacancy rates.

2. Increased Occupancy Rates

Leasing agents play a crucial role in maintaining high occupancy rates. Their ability to market the property effectively and provide excellent service during the leasing process attracts new tenants. High occupancy rates directly translate to increased revenue and profitability for the property.

3. Efficient Maintenance and Repairs

A well-staffed maintenance team ensures that repairs and maintenance tasks are handled quickly and efficiently. This keeps the property in good condition and prevents minor issues from becoming major problems. Prompt maintenance contributes to tenant satisfaction and helps preserve the property’s value.

4. Improved Financial Management

Accountants and bookkeepers ensure that the property is managed accurately and transparently. Effective financial management allows property managers to make informed decisions, plan for future investments, and ensure that the property remains financially stable.

5. Enhanced Property Reputation

The reputation of a property can significantly impact its success. Professional and effective staff contribute to a positive reputation by providing excellent service, maintaining the property well, and handling issues promptly. A good reputation attracts high-quality tenants and can justify higher rental rates.

6. Legal Compliance

Property management involves navigating a complex landscape of laws and regulations. Knowledgeable staff ensure that the property complies with all local, state, and federal regulations. This reduces the risk of legal issues and potential fines, protecting the property’s health and reputation.
